Strategies for Contractors to Win Big in Infrastructure Projects

Expansive aerial view of highway interchange in infrastructure project.

Unlocking Big Opportunities: The Key to Winning Infrastructure Projects

For contractors navigating the ever-evolving landscape of infrastructure projects, success isn’t merely about securing contracts; it’s about understanding the dynamics at play and strategically positioning oneself at the forefront of opportunity. With increasing governmental investments in infrastructure, especially in the wake of economic recovery, contractors who can adapt and innovate are poised to not only compete but thrive.

Understanding Modern Infrastructure Needs

Recent trends highlight a significant push towards modernizing existing infrastructure. Projects that once seemed routine, like bridge repairs or road upgrades, are now being infused with cutting-edge technology and sustainability practices that appeal to environmentally conscious stakeholders. By embracing these trends, contractors can showcase their commitment to progressive practices, making them more attractive to potential clients.

Networking: A Contractor’s Greatest Asset

Building strong relationships within the industry is crucial. Successful contractors often emphasize the importance of networking with public agencies, local government officials, and even fellow contractors. This relational dynamic can lead to essential information about upcoming projects and potential collaborative opportunities. Consider attending industry-focused events where decision-makers converge, as these platforms can significantly enhance your visibility and credibility.

Leveraging Technology and Innovation

In today’s construction landscape, embracing technology has become a non-negotiable. From project management software that streamlines scheduling to Building Information Modeling (BIM) that enhances design accuracy, technology facilitates better communication and efficiency on-site. Staying abreast of the latest advancements not only cuts costs but also positions contractors as industry leaders capable of delivering on complex requirements.

Bid Smart: Strategies for Competitive Edge

Winning bids is about more than just price; it involves demonstrating value. Crafting proposals that showcase experience, innovative approaches, and solutions to potential risks can set contractors apart from the competition. Additionally, aligning bids with ongoing sustainability initiatives is increasingly becoming a winning strategy, as many clients now prioritize environmentally friendly practices.

Continuous Learning: A Pathway to Excellence

The construction industry is ever-changing, and continuous education is vital for contractors looking to remain relevant. By investing in training programs or certifications related to new technologies and sustainable practices, contractors not only enhance their skillsets but also bolster their company’s reputation. This knowledge can translate into smoother project execution and increased client satisfaction.

As the infrastructure sector burgeons, contractors who actively engage with current trends, utilize technology, foster networks, bid wisely, and commit to lifelong learning will find themselves at the leading edge of opportunity. With the right strategies in place, winning big in infrastructure projects is not just a possibility—it can be your reality.

Quanta vs PSEG: A Legal Showdown Over Long Island's Energy Future

Update Quanta's Legal Battle for Grid Efficiency In a bold move that could reshape the energy landscape of Long Island, Quanta Services has taken action to halt a lucrative grid contract awarded to PSEG. The company, known for its extensive work in the energy and telecommunications sectors, has filed a lawsuit seeking to block the contract awarded by the New York State’s Public Service Commission (PSC). The contention arises from concerns over cost efficiency and project delivery timelines, crucial elements for clients within the construction and energy sectors. A Closer Look at the Stakes Quanta is not just throwing legal darts in the dark. Their challenge is grounded in a belief that the PSC’s decision might not reflect the best interests of cost management or project efficiency. With energy prices soaring and stakeholders becoming increasingly budget-conscious, Quanta’s litigation speaks to a pivotal issue of our times: how much our contract awards impact the efficiency and quality of public works. Ironically, this situation echoes recent discussions around smart construction technologies that aim to streamline projects and minimize waste, areas in which Quanta typically excels. The Impact of Legal Decisions on Construction Projects Every legal decision not only shapes corporate relationships but also determines how projects roll out on the ground. A potential halt to the PSEG contract could delay several grid improvements that are vital for Long Island residents and businesses. Each flowing wire and connecting cable represents not just infrastructure, but jobs, innovation, and a cleaner future. Contract disputes like these highlight the critical intersection between law and construction, reminding industry players to remain vigilant about their partnerships and contracts.
